Output ed28bacf851d81187ad3728b0f017b77eaf27ca6fd8390b12a2f1b0f03815dc8:2

value
69650198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3962e82af4236a7bd2abdf42c01e1a25d3eb7c2a OP_EQUAL
address
MD8bEY61QeyXTEmXwSbsTuKg3LXAEHQBEi
transaction
ed28bacf851d81187ad3728b0f017b77eaf27ca6fd8390b12a2f1b0f03815dc8
spent
true